What Is Puff Count: Quit Vaping Now?

Puff Count is a mobile application designed to assist users in reducing or eliminating their vaping habits through data-driven tracking, goal setting, and social accountability. Targeting individuals motivated by health improvements and habit cessation, the app positions itself as a comprehensive 'quit coach' that leverages usage monitoring and custom planning to guide users toward a nicotine-free lifestyle. While the app offers a robust feature set, its market positioning is currently undermined by its monetization strategy. The core differentiator is its focus on community-based accountability and adaptive quit plans, yet these benefits are currently overshadowed by negative user sentiment regarding pricing and perceived deceptive paywalls.

Key Features

Quit BuddiesDifferentiator

Social accountability feature allowing users to invite friends and track each other's progress

Custom Quit PlanDifferentiator

Personalized roadmap with adaptive daily limits to guide users toward quitting

Usage MonitorStandard

Visualization of vaping habits through daily, weekly, and monthly graphs

Trigger RecognitionDifferentiator

Tracking statistics and tendencies to help users identify and avoid vaping triggers

Nicotine Strength TrackingStandard

Logging Mg levels to monitor total nicotine consumption

Goal TrackingBasic

Setting and monitoring personal milestones for quitting

Pain Points

Deceptive Paywall/Pricing

They are not upfront with price until after you sign up.

It says no in app purchases, first screen is a forced in app purchase

High Subscription Costs

It’s here to make you pay for your time, $10 a week or $60 a month!?!?

I’d rather just track the puffs myself. I was excited to use this app now it makes me want to continue vaping.

Lack of Free Functionality

Not a single free function in the app.

I don’t even use the premium features, all I want to be able to do is track my puffs and that’s it.

Puff Count: Quit Vaping Now Pros and Cons

Pros

  • Strong, clear value proposition centered on a high-intent health niche.
  • Feature-rich environment including social accountability and trigger tracking.
  • Established user base with over 800,000 downloads.

Cons

  • Aggressive and non-transparent monetization strategy leading to 'bait-and-switch' complaints.
  • High price point relative to the value perceived by users.
  • Lack of a functional free tier, which is standard for habit-tracking apps.

Market Outlook

Growth Opportunities

  • Pivot to a more transparent pricing model (e.g., ad-supported free tier or lower-cost one-time purchase).
  • Capitalize on the 'Quit Buddy' feature by building a more robust community forum or support group.
  • Improve onboarding transparency to rebuild trust with new users.

Market Threats

  • Competitors offering free, high-quality habit tracking can easily capture this user base.
  • Potential for negative App Store reviews to permanently damage brand reputation.
  • Regulatory scrutiny regarding health-related apps and deceptive subscription practices.
